One of the members of top hip hop and RnB group Major Playaz, Chyllur Chihava has made a return to the local music scene, with a new single entitled “Horror”.
The song that had its radio release last week continues to receive rave reviews with fans appreciating his unique vocals and lyrical prowess.
Speaking on the track, the soft-spoken musician said the move marked the start of his solo career.
“The song is taken off my 15 track album that will be released at the end of this month. It basically speaks about jealously in a relationship, something which a lot of people can relate to,” he said.
Chyllur said his music was not so different from the Major Playaz brand they created years ago, a deliberate move meant to rekindle memories.
“Music does evolve but I have taken the time to research in the industry while staying true to the international style that we always used to do as Major Playaz. With time however, the music will reflect more about me,” he said.
Chyllur also shed light on the current state of affairs of the group, saying the other two members – Thomas and Richard Marufu – were sharpening their musical skills abroad.
“We took a break from doing music because the other two guys left the country to pursue their education. We are still in touch and when they eventually return we will reunite. For now, I am solo. In fact I never stopped doing music,” he said.
While his appearance resembles the boy next door, his work presents an edgy artiste with an even sinister music cover of a girl holding a bloody knife.
However, his album confirms his bad boy side with songs like “Someone’s Girl” where he sings about being in love with his fiend’s girlfriend.
“The album has party and dance songs. There are also a number of relationship and love songs as well,” said the musician who also says he is not in a relationship.
